A recorded online interview first then panel interview with a few folks who work there now. The recorded interview is short and not intimidating despite having to record yourself. The questions are reasonable and you get two chances to record your response.

Zoom interview with the two interviewees. Questions were the standard ones about teaching philosophy, background and practices. No hard questions, all softballs. They then tell you onboard training is unpaid.
Pretty standard interview process. Started through a recruiter, then a second interview with a panel from the marketing team, followed by a final interview with the department head to verify cultural fit with the team. Moved through the process in about 2-3 weeks
